If you don't complete the compulsory language test prior to your stay abroad, you won't get Erasmus status (neither with a scholarship nor as a zero grant student). If you don't complete the language test 3 weeks after you return from your period abroad, you will not have met all the requirements, and your Erasmus status will be revoked. You will then have to repay any scholarship amount (70%) previously received.
